Output 42489cd7ab75c56301f401ac1956d97160643a7ecceb0262b9e0e210d906646b:2

value
602596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e78f445ad56ee531b568e796b713b44fea79b80b OP_EQUAL
address
3NoPeDtV5ecqDY4whsk2omdL5EXSgYWfUt
transaction
42489cd7ab75c56301f401ac1956d97160643a7ecceb0262b9e0e210d906646b
spent
true